Having successfully upgraded and used MLS 2.9 on the 31 Aug. 2008. Last Sunday the 7 Sept. when I tried to connect (We use a dial up connection) a message popped up saying that 'no logon script had been selected'. Following the information, in the popup, I navigated to the relevant System area, to be offered a choice, I think of 4, scripts. Having no idea of which one to select, I noticed an option to ignore scripts. Crossing fingers, I duly selected and 'Saved'. Normal operation was resumed and downloads etc. carried out without any further apparent problems.
My questions are:
1. When and what are the logon scripts used for?
2. Why did MLS work OK one week and not the next?
(The instructions to shut-down the computer, after the upgrade, before first use, were followed to the letter).
